How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Minnetonka Beach?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Minnetonka Beach Studio Apartments | $1,306 | $1,085 | $2,187 |
Minnetonka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,671 | $1,070 | $3,150 |
Minnetonka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,615 | $1,125 | $7,500 |
Minnetonka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,708 | $1,350 | $9,395 |
Minnetonka Beach 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,399 | $3,350 | $3,499 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Minnetonka Beach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Minnetonka Beach?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Minnetonka Beach is at Plymouth Colony listed at $1,070.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Minnetonka Beach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Minnetonka Beach is $1,656.
What is the largest Utilities Included Minnetonka Beach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Minnetonka Beach is a 1,505 square feet unit starting from $2,065 at Quayside Wayzata.
What is the average size for Minnetonka Beach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Minnetonka Beach is currently at 765 sq ft.
